Yesterday the health visitor came round for that follow-up appt I arranged about weaning. She said he is doing fine, but I should try him on lumpier foods now, and more finger foods, which is fine by me! She reassured me about the gagging and retching thing and said he will get used to it. Phew. He loves melon in his baby safe feeder now. I give it to him frozen to help his gums as he bites on it, but he eats it when it has thawed :) He also loves a nice lump of cheddar cheese (organic of course! :) ) and ate one nearly all up yesterday!
